Portugal has been committed to the Energy Transition, from the beginning of the 21st century, being today one of the world frontrunners on this field.

Portugal has been applying an ambitious and successful plan to promote electricity production from renewables. Portugal has a huge potential on the renewables, namely, hydropower, wind, solar, biomass and wave energy.

Therefore, Portugal has committed to an ambitious target for 2020, reaching a renewables share in gross final energy consumption of 31%. By the end of 2017, Portugal had already an installed capacity of 14.4 GW from renewable technologies, accounting for 64 % of total capacity.

In March 2018, Portugal`s monthly renewable energy production exceeded the power demand on the mainland electricity consumption, generating more renewable energy than it needed.

The Portuguese energy policy has contributed to the development of a highly skilled workforce and of an energy industry cluster ready to deliver advanced renewable energy technology. Adding to the broad socio-economic outcomes, the public policies on energy contributed to the development of renewable energy markets.

Due to the notable cost evolution of the renewables technological progress and the superb natural geographic conditions of the country, Portugal took a further step in the energy transition to a market based on renewable energy investment. In Portugal, we have already been able to license 968 MW of solar PV capacity fully market-based projects.

Although, the Interconnections are a key issue for achieving a sustainable energy system and the ambition of Portugal in terms of renewables is closely related with the electricity interconnections capacity.

In recent times, Portugal has strongly supported the 32% EU – wide binding target for renewables by 2030 as well as, binding electricity interconnection capacity targets of 10% by 2020 and 15% by 2030 for the Members States. These targets were just agreed by the European Council and by Parliament.
